Quick context for the board: our current BeanBank scheme is tired — redemption rates are down and younger customers barely register. The proposed overhaul, dubbed Copper Circle, shifts to app-based tiers with partner perks from Hollis Bakeries. Early pilot numbers from the Westmere and Tarn Street sites look genuinely promising, with visit frequency up double digits. We'll need a call on funding phasing at the next session. The confidential note below covers related business plans.

board note of kafog-bajep: Briathek Partners is in early talks to buy Aldaelek Group for about $47.1 million. The Ulaath launch date is September 4, and nothing goes to the press before then.

Ticket: Proctoring queue consumer failing — expired credentials

Welcome aboard. The Vantrell exam-proctoring queue stopped draining last night because the service account credential for the Opaline queue broker lapsed. Students' session events are backing up, so treat this as high priority. A fresh credential has been issued through the Harwick vault process. Paste it into the consumer's config exactly as issued.

service key, fawip-bajef: kto11_Qt5wZK9vdNC

# Build Provenance: Nightly Search Reindex

The Brindlewood search cluster is reindexed nightly by the `reindex-full` job, which runs from a pinned container image built by the Hollis pipeline. Reviewers should confirm three things: the image digest matches the signed manifest, the schema version in the job config matches the index mapping in the repo, and the job ran from a tagged commit, not a branch head. Provenance attestations are stored alongside artifacts for ninety days. The attested build for last night's run appears below.

pipeline stamp: htk9_ce63042d9

Q3 Planning — Vexalon Launch. Finance team: budget envelope for the Vexalon launch is locked at prior-quarter levels. Marketing spend front-loaded to weeks 1–4; channel rebates deferred to Q4. Headcount flat. Revenue recognition follows standard terms. Margin targets unchanged from the Marlowe review. Further detail on the launch strategy follows below.

internal memo for kawip-hadug: Headcount on the Wenwyn team goes from 7 to 140 by the end of January. Gross margin on Wenwyn came in at 20 percent against a plan of 15 percent.